The mucus plug can come loose several days or even one or two weeks before labor starts. How Long After Losing the Mucus Plug Does Labor Start?Īlthough losing the mucus plug can be a sign of labor, it doesn’t always mean it’s baby time in the near future. Increased vaginal discharge is common throughout pregnancy, whereas the mucus plug acts like a barrier and typically isn’t expelled until later in your pregnancy. The mucus plug is thick and jelly-like, whereas vaginal discharge tends to be thinner or lighter in texture and consistency. Vaginal discharge, on the other hand, is usually light yellow or white. As you read above, the mucus plug is typically clear or off-white, but might appear red, brown, or pink if it mixes with blood in your cervix. So, if you’re wondering if it’s the mucus plug you see or normal vaginal discharge, here’s how you can tell:Ĭolor. Is It the Mucus Plug or Vaginal Discharge?īecause vaginal discharge is common during pregnancy, it’s easy to mistake this for the mucus plug, especially as you near labor. Thick, jelly-like, and slightly sticky and/or stringyĪnywhere from one to two inches in lengthĪnywhere from one to two tablespoons in volume The overall look and texture of a mucus plug will vary from person to person, but most commonly the plug will be:Ĭlear, off-white, or slightly bloody with a pink, red, or brown hue You might notice it on the toilet paper after you wipe, or you may not see it at all! If you notice bleeding that’s heavy, like a menstrual period, contact your healthcare provider, as this might not be the mucus plug coming out but something else that may require medical attention. The mucus can come out in one thick string, one big glob, or in smaller segments. Your body temperature usually drops a little before you ovulate, and then goes up and stays a little higher for a few days. With other kits, you need to take your temperature in order to check where you are in your menstruation cycle. Some involve taking urine tests to check for hormonal spikes that occur during ovulation. There are different types of ovulation tests and fertility monitoring kits you can buy. That’s why experts usually recommend using a more accurate method of fertility tracking, such as fertility monitoring. While it’s possible to track your fertility by focusing on your cervical mucus throughout the month, it may be challenging to rely on this method to determine when you’re at your most fertile. Recording the characteristics of your cervical mucus throughout the month may reveal patterns in your ovulation, helping you determine when you’re most fertile. You’re less likely to get pregnant when you notice cloudy and sticky mucus, or when you feel dry. This is the time when you’re most likely to get pregnant. ![]() When your cervical mucus is clear and slippery, you’re probably about to ovulate. If you carefully track your discharge, it may be possible to track the days when you are most fertile. ![]() Most women’s bodies produce a very specific kind of mucus right before ovulation. ![]() Can cervical mucus tell you when you’re most fertile?
